#79200e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#79200e is composed of 47.5% red, 12.5% green and 5.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 73.6% magenta, 88.4% yellow and 52.5% black. It has a hue angle of 10.1 degrees, a saturation of 79.3% and a lightness of 26.5%. #79200e color hex could be obtained by blending #f2401c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

Shades and Tints of #79200e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100402 is the darkest color, while #fffd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#79200e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#454242 is the less saturated color, while #831904 is the most saturated one.
